Quantum Spark 1600 - show configuration issue
Hi,
We have a Quantum Spark 1600 device running R81.10.05 (996001305).
Configured BGP successfully to another Check Point gateway but noticed the following issues:
1. Adding a Peer group via Web UI does not reflect in the WEB UI
2. In clish you cannot see your BGP configuration, can only run the "show bgp .." commands.
It would be nice to be able to run commands like you can in GAIA like "show configuration bgp", etc.
Is this in the pipeline?

Are the BGP commands present in the full show configuration output?
According to sk178604 (reference: 01475633) dynamic routing configuration should appear in the CLI show configuration output, I would suggest a TAC case if you see different.
Alternatively you're also welcome to try the newer release firmware being R81.10.07
Other/new command variations are likely to be deemed RFEs that you would need to take with your local CP SE.

To add to my 1st response, unless something was drastically changed in clish in the brand new firmware, I highly doubt behavior would be any diifferent. I just did a little check and on regular Gaia, if you are in clish and type show configuration and hit Tab, it gives you all the options you can type. In embedded Gaia, that is NOT the case, does not give a single thing.

Looks like it is related to sk164018.
There might be missing info in "show configuration" relating to dynamic routing
Going to update firmware to latest
